The incubator requires a dedicated AC 220V, 50 Hz power supply and an ambient temperature between +5 and +30°C for proper operation. The unit must be transported upright and positioned with clear access to all chamber interfaces for cleaning and maintenance.
- Power Supply: Connect the incubator to a dedicated AC 220V, 50 Hz power outlet to ensure stable operation.
- Ambient Temperature: Maintain the surrounding air temperature between +5 and +30°C to avoid performance degradation.
- Transport Orientation: Keep the packed incubator upright at all times during transport and use appropriate lifting equipment.
- Chamber Access: Ensure the chamber, shelves, filters, and control interfaces remain accessible for routine cleaning and inspection.
- Optional Accessories: Select and install optional accessories such as humidity display, printer, or HEPA filtration according to the specific workflow requirements.

What is the CO2 recovery time after a door opening for the 190 L Gas-Jacket UV Sterilization CO2 Incubator?
The CO2 recovery time is no more than 3 minutes to return to 5% CO2 concentration after a 30-second door opening, as specified for the AF-CO2E-190G model. This rapid recovery supports stable, repeatable cell culture conditions during routine laboratory access.
How does the infrared CO2 sensor in the Atomfair AF-CO2E-190G achieve ±0.1% control accuracy?
The incubator uses an infrared (IR) CO2 sensor that provides a control accuracy of ±0.1% across the 0–20% CO2 range. This sensor technology supports stable, repeatable CO2 control in routine cell culture workflows, as stated in the product specifications.
What are the power supply and space requirements for installing the 190 L CO2 incubator?
The incubator requires an AC 220 V, 50 Hz power supply with a rated power of 750 W. External dimensions are 708 × 710 × 1030 mm (W × D × H), and the unit must be placed in an ambient temperature range of +5 to +30 °C. Ensure the chamber, sensors, and control interfaces remain accessible for maintenance and cleaning as per the handling instructions.
The 190 L Gas-Jacket UV Sterilization CO2 Incubator with IR sensor provides ±0.1% CO2 accuracy and rapid recovery after door openings, but relies on natural evaporation for humidity and requires ambient temperatures between +5 and +30 °C for stable operation.
Positive
- Infrared CO2 sensing with fast recovery: CO2 control accuracy of ±0.1% with recovery to 5% CO2 in ≤3 minutes after a 30-second door opening, enabling stable culture conditions.
- Gas-jacket UV sterilization and optional HEPA: Gas-jacket thermal design combined with UV sterilization and optional HEPA filtration supports contamination control and chamber hygiene for sensitive cell culture workflows.
Trade-offs
- Limited ambient temperature range: The incubator requires a working ambient temperature of +5 to +30 °C; performance may degrade outside this range, restricting placement to climate-controlled laboratory spaces.
- Humidity controlled only by natural evaporation: Relative humidity is maintained via natural evaporation at ≥90% without active regulation; precise humidity control and display require optional accessories, limiting suitability for humidity-critical applications.
